1 line
6.7 KiB
JSON
1 line
6.7 KiB
JSON
{"remainingRequest":"D:\\phpstudy_pro\\WWW\\travel\\admin\\node_modules\\vue-loader\\lib\\index.js??vue-loader-options!D:\\phpstudy_pro\\WWW\\travel\\admin\\src\\views\\dashboard\\admin\\index.vue?vue&type=script&lang=js","dependencies":[{"path":"D:\\phpstudy_pro\\WWW\\travel\\admin\\src\\views\\dashboard\\admin\\index.vue","mtime":1718765310639},{"path":"D:\\phpstudy_pro\\WWW\\travel\\admin\\node_modules\\cache-loader\\dist\\cjs.js","mtime":1718764957200},{"path":"D:\\phpstudy_pro\\WWW\\travel\\admin\\node_modules\\babel-loader\\lib\\index.js","mtime":1718764959024},{"path":"D:\\phpstudy_pro\\WWW\\travel\\admin\\node_modules\\cache-loader\\dist\\cjs.js","mtime":1718764957200},{"path":"D:\\phpstudy_pro\\WWW\\travel\\admin\\node_modules\\vue-loader\\lib\\index.js","mtime":1718764959862}],"contextDependencies":[],"result":[{"type":"Buffer","data":"base64:Ly8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KLy8KDQppbXBvcnQgUGFuZWxHcm91cCBmcm9tICcuL2NvbXBvbmVudHMvUGFuZWxHcm91cCcNCmltcG9ydCBMaW5lQ2hhcnQgZnJvbSAnLi9jb21wb25lbnRzL0xpbmVDaGFydCcNCmltcG9ydCBSYWRkYXJDaGFydCBmcm9tICcuL2NvbXBvbmVudHMvUmFkZGFyQ2hhcnQnDQppbXBvcnQgUGllQ2hhcnQgZnJvbSAnLi9jb21wb25lbnRzL1BpZUNoYXJ0Jw0KaW1wb3J0IEJhckNoYXJ0IGZyb20gJy4vY29tcG9uZW50cy9CYXJDaGFydCcNCmltcG9ydCBUcmFuc2FjdGlvblRhYmxlIGZyb20gJy4vY29tcG9uZW50cy9UcmFuc2FjdGlvblRhYmxlJw0KaW1wb3J0IFRvZG9MaXN0IGZyb20gJy4vY29tcG9uZW50cy9Ub2RvTGlzdCcNCmltcG9ydCBCb3hDYXJkIGZyb20gJy4vY29tcG9uZW50cy9Cb3hDYXJkJw0KDQpjb25zdCBsaW5lQ2hhcnREYXRhID0gew0KICBuZXdWaXNpdGlzOiB7DQogICAgZXhwZWN0ZWREYXRhOiBbMTAwLCAxMjAsIDE2MSwgMTM0LCAxMDUsIDE2MCwgMTY1XSwNCiAgICBhY3R1YWxEYXRhOiBbMTIwLCA4MiwgOTEsIDE1NCwgMTYyLCAxNDAsIDE0NV0NCiAgfSwNCiAgbWVzc2FnZXM6IHsNCiAgICBleHBlY3RlZERhdGE6IFsyMDAsIDE5MiwgMTIwLCAxNDQsIDE2MCwgMTMwLCAxNDBdLA0KICAgIGFjdHVhbERhdGE6IFsxODAsIDE2MCwgMTUxLCAxMDYsIDE0NSwgMTUwLCAxMzBdDQogIH0sDQogIHB1cmNoYXNlczogew0KICAgIGV4cGVjdGVkRGF0YTogWzgwLCAxMDAsIDEyMSwgMTA0LCAxMDUsIDkwLCAxMDBdLA0KICAgIGFjdHVhbERhdGE6IFsxMjAsIDkwLCAxMDAsIDEzOCwgMTQyLCAxMzAsIDEzMF0NCiAgfSwNCiAgc2hvcHBpbmdzOiB7DQogICAgZXhwZWN0ZWREYXRhOiBbMTMwLCAxNDAsIDE0MSwgMTQyLCAxNDUsIDE1MCwgMTYwXSwNCiAgICBhY3R1YWxEYXRhOiBbMTIwLCA4MiwgOTEsIDE1NCwgMTYyLCAxNDAsIDEzMF0NCiAgfQ0KfQ0KDQpleHBvcnQgZGVmYXVsdCB7DQogIG5hbWU6ICdEYXNoYm9hcmRBZG1pbicsDQogIGNvbXBvbmVudHM6IHsNCiAgICBQYW5lbEdyb3VwLA0KICAgIExpbmVDaGFydCwNCiAgICBSYWRkYXJDaGFydCwNCiAgICBQaWVDaGFydCwNCiAgICBCYXJDaGFydCwNCiAgICBUcmFuc2FjdGlvblRhYmxlLA0KICAgIFRvZG9MaXN0LA0KICAgIEJveENhcmQNCiAgfSwNCiAgZGF0YSgpIHsNCiAgICByZXR1cm4gew0KICAgICAgbGluZUNoYXJ0RGF0YTogbnVsbA0KICAgIH0NCiAgfSwNCiAgY3JlYXRlZCgpew0KICAgIHRoaXMuJGF4aW9zLmdldCgnL2FkbWluL2luZGV4L2xpbmUnLCB7IHBhcmFtczogdGhpcy5saXN0UXVlcnkgfSkudGhlbihyZXNwb25zZSA9PiB7DQogICAgICB0aGlzLmxpbmVDaGFydERhdGEgPSByZXNwb25zZS5kYXRhDQogICAgfSkNCiAgfSwNCiAgbWV0aG9kczogew0KICAgIGhhbmRsZVNldExpbmVDaGFydERhdGEodHlwZSkgew0KICAgICAgdGhpcy5saW5lQ2hhcnREYXRhID0gbGluZUNoYXJ0RGF0YVt0eXBlXQ0KICAgIH0NCiAgfQ0KfQ0K"},{"version":3,"sources":["index.vue"],"names":[],"mappings":";;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;AAuCA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;;AAEA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;;AAEA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A;AACA","file":"index.vue","sourceRoot":"src/views/dashboard/admin","sourcesContent":["<template>\r\n <div class=\"dashboard-editor-container\">\r\n\r\n <panel-group @handleSetLineChartData=\"handleSetLineChartData\" />\r\n\r\n <el-row v-if=\"lineChartData\" style=\"background:#fff;padding:16px 16px 0;margin-bottom:32px;\">\r\n <line-chart :chart-data=\"lineChartData\" />\r\n </el-row>\r\n\r\n <el-row :gutter=\"32\">\r\n <!-- <el-col :xs=\"24\" :sm=\"24\" :lg=\"8\">\r\n <div class=\"chart-wrapper\">\r\n <raddar-chart />\r\n </div>\r\n </el-col> -->\r\n <el-col :xs=\"24\" :sm=\"24\" :lg=\"8\">\r\n <div class=\"chart-wrapper\">\r\n <pie-chart />\r\n </div>\r\n </el-col>\r\n <!-- <el-col :xs=\"24\" :sm=\"24\" :lg=\"8\">\r\n <div class=\"chart-wrapper\">\r\n <bar-chart />\r\n </div>\r\n </el-col> -->\r\n </el-row>\r\n\r\n <!-- <el-row :gutter=\"8\">\r\n <el-col :xs=\"{span: 24}\" :sm=\"{span: 24}\" :md=\"{span: 24}\" :lg=\"{span: 12}\" :xl=\"{span: 12}\" style=\"padding-right:8px;margin-bottom:30px;\">\r\n <transaction-table />\r\n </el-col>\r\n <el-col :xs=\"{span: 24}\" :sm=\"{span: 12}\" :md=\"{span: 12}\" :lg=\"{span: 12}\" :xl=\"{span: 12}\" style=\"margin-bottom:30px;\">\r\n <todo-list />\r\n </el-col>\r\n </el-row> -->\r\n </div>\r\n</template>\r\n\r\n<script>\r\nimport PanelGroup from './components/PanelGroup'\r\nimport LineChart from './components/LineChart'\r\nimport RaddarChart from './components/RaddarChart'\r\nimport PieChart from './components/PieChart'\r\nimport BarChart from './components/BarChart'\r\nimport TransactionTable from './components/TransactionTable'\r\nimport TodoList from './components/TodoList'\r\nimport BoxCard from './components/BoxCard'\r\n\r\nconst lineChartData = {\r\n newVisitis: {\r\n expectedData: [100, 120, 161, 134, 105, 160, 165],\r\n actualData: [120, 82, 91, 154, 162, 140, 145]\r\n },\r\n messages: {\r\n expectedData: [200, 192, 120, 144, 160, 130, 140],\r\n actualData: [180, 160, 151, 106, 145, 150, 130]\r\n },\r\n purchases: {\r\n expectedData: [80, 100, 121, 104, 105, 90, 100],\r\n actualData: [120, 90, 100, 138, 142, 130, 130]\r\n },\r\n shoppings: {\r\n expectedData: [130, 140, 141, 142, 145, 150, 160],\r\n actualData: [120, 82, 91, 154, 162, 140, 130]\r\n }\r\n}\r\n\r\nexport default {\r\n name: 'DashboardAdmin',\r\n components: {\r\n PanelGroup,\r\n LineChart,\r\n RaddarChart,\r\n PieChart,\r\n BarChart,\r\n TransactionTable,\r\n TodoList,\r\n BoxCard\r\n },\r\n data() {\r\n return {\r\n lineChartData: null\r\n }\r\n },\r\n created(){\r\n this.$axios.get('/admin/index/line', { params: this.listQuery }).then(response => {\r\n this.lineChartData = response.data\r\n })\r\n },\r\n methods: {\r\n handleSetLineChartData(type) {\r\n this.lineChartData = lineChartData[type]\r\n }\r\n }\r\n}\r\n</script>\r\n\r\n<style lang=\"scss\" scoped>\r\n.dashboard-editor-container {\r\n padding: 32px;\r\n background-color: rgb(240, 242, 245);\r\n position: relative;\r\n\r\n .github-corner {\r\n position: absolute;\r\n top: 0px;\r\n border: 0;\r\n right: 0;\r\n }\r\n\r\n .chart-wrapper {\r\n background: #fff;\r\n padding: 16px 16px 0;\r\n margin-bottom: 32px;\r\n }\r\n}\r\n\r\n@media (max-width:1024px) {\r\n .chart-wrapper {\r\n padding: 8px;\r\n }\r\n}\r\n</style>\r\n"]}]} |